Chapter 86 Talisman vs Bone Corpse

Bone corpse?!

Ye Ning learned from "An Anecdotes of the Cultivator" that some sects specialize in cultivating corpses, which can be refined into various zombies comparable to monks. However, this was the first time he saw the bone rack directly commanding the battle. The bone rack was shining with a pale light mixed with Yin Mi's strange scream, which became even more gloomy and terrifying. Ye Ning felt that his heartbeat was about to stop, and his hand holding the hilt of the sword dripped straight.

It's approaching!

Ten zhang, five zhang, three zhang...

Finally, the first skeleton jumped up and cut his fingers towards Ye Ning like a knife.

No matter what, Ye Ning gritted his teeth, raised the silver-in sword in his hand like cutting tofu, cutting the skeleton's fingers. However, the skeleton had no pain, and the forearm suddenly flew up, causing the strong wind to hit Ye Ning's shoulder. The power of this blow was comparable to that of the early stage of the innate stage, and Ye Ning could bear it. It can be seen that this skeleton has the strength of the early stage of the innate stage. A skeleton in the early stage of the innate stage is not terrible, but what is terrible is that there are nearly ten thousand skeletons around Ye Ning!

Moreover, Ye Ning saw that there was a dark green skeleton that was two heads taller than the ordinary skeleton! The smell came from the skeleton, and there was an unknown liquid dripping downwards. Each drop corroded the bluestone floor into a big hole!

If Ye Ning was an ordinary peak innate warrior, he would undoubtedly die in this situation. However, he had a stream-like spiritual power in his body, and he had nearly ten thousand talismans in his arms, so he was naturally unwilling to surrender.

Frost sky and water shadow—

He was as fast as the wind, like a flexible and changeable little fish, shuttled back and forth in the attack web composed of many skeletons.

Bang! Bang! Bang! Bang!

The pale skeleton was constantly frozen and turned into powder under the attack of the Yinlin Sword. The skeleton was fearless and rushed forward one after another. Soon a thick layer of white bone chips was piled up under Ye Ning's feet. From a distance, it seemed like a heavy snowfall was falling.

Looking at the skeletons, Ye Ning's face turned pale. Most of the spiritual power in his body had been consumed. At this moment, he relied on his strong true energy to activate the "frost sky". The effect was no longer obvious. He could only slightly slow down the skeleton's pace. Looking at the skeleton that was still emerging, Ye Ning was helpless. He gritted his teeth and had to use the talisman in his arms.

Using one talisman with less than one talisman is his biggest way to deal with Yin Mi!

At this moment, it is a waste to deal with the skeleton.

Explosion Talisman! Flame Talisman! Ice Talisman!…

Various types of talismans were thrown around, and suddenly, there was a constant explosion. Each talisman could blow away several skeletons, and the attack slowed down in a moment.
